Location: London Gatwick Airport

Hours: Various shifts - Full Time or Part Time roles available

Pay rate: £12.92p/h

Contract length: Temporary ongoing

Blue Arrow is currently recruiting General Assistants to join our client in a successful and fast-paced operation at Gatwick Airport. This is a key role supporting airline customers by ensuring catering products and equipment are prepared and delivered on time, in line with strict schedules and quality standards.

The Role

  • Production
  • Preparing and plating food
  • Handling packed food items
  • Packing amenity kits and flight condiments
  • Equipment
  • Stacking and organising shelves
  • Stock rotation
  • Re-ordering dry stock
  • General cleaning duties
  • Waste removal
  • Washing airline equipment to required industry standards

Requirements

  • To be considered for this role, you must:
  • Be able to handle pork and alcohol products
  • Be comfortable standing for long periods and have good mobility
  • Be able to work in a chilled environment
  • Have a basic understanding of English
